First Minister's Questions

Thursday 16 March 2017 12:00 PM

LIVE

Details

Ruth Davidson S5F-01028 1. To ask the First Minister what engagements she has planned for the rest of the day. Kezia Dugdale S5F-01027 2. To ask the First Minister what engagements she has planned for the rest of the week. Willie Rennie S5F-01025 3. To ask the First Minister what issues will be discussed at the next meeting of the Cabinet. Clare Adamson S5F-01032 4. To ask the First Minister what guidance the Scottish Government has issued regarding the use of the Pupil Equity Fund. Annie Wells S5F-01034 5. To ask the First Minister what action the Scottish Government is taking to tackle gun crime. Daniel Johnson S5F-01060 6. To ask the First Minister how the Scottish Government will ensure that changes to unit assessments will not increase teacher workload, in light of reports that 63% of teachers believe that they will.
